DISSOLUTION OF PARTNERSHIP.
NOTICE is hereby given that the partnership heretofore subsisting between John Alexander Niblock and Arthur Thomas Bell carrying on business as Barristers and Solicitors at 176 Hereford Street, Christchurch, under the style or firm of Niblock and Bell has been dissolved as from the 13th day of June, 1939, as from which date the business will be carried on by Arthur Thomas Bell under the style or firm of Niblock and Bell.
Dated at Christchurch, this 14th day of June, 1939.
J. A. NIBLOCK.
A. T. BELL.

BOROUGH OF ROTORUA.
RESOLUTION MAKING SPECIAL RATE.
IN pursuance and exercise of the powers vested in it in that behalf by the Local Bodies' Loans Act, 1926, the Rotorua Borough Council hereby resolves as follows :– “That, for the purpose of providing the interest and other charges on a loan of £3,000, authorized to be raised by the Rotorua Borough Council under the above-mentioned Act, for the purpose of purchasing materials, providing transport, tools, &c., and payment of the Council's share of wages on works subsidized from the Employment Promotion Fund, the said Rotorua Borough Council hereby makes and levies a special rate of .038 pence in the pound upon the rateable value of all rateable property of the Borough of Rotorua; and that such special rate shall be an annual-recurring rate during the currency of such loan, and be payable yearly on the 1st day of April in each and every year during the currency of such loan, being a period of ten years, or until the loan is fully paid off.”
W. A. McLEAN,
Town Clerk.

RULES OF THE ROYAL SOCIETY OF NEW ZEALAND AMENDED.
IT is hereby notified that at a meeting of the Council of the Royal Society of New Zealand held on the 23rd May, 1939, the following amendments to the Rules of the Royal Society of New Zealand, published in New Zealand Gazette No. 84 of the 14th November, 1935, were made :—
SECTION C.—RELATING TO CUSTODY OF PROPERTY AND COMMON SEAL.
Rescind Rule 3 and substitute the following :— “The seal formerly used by the New Zealand Institute, but with the legend thereon deleted, and the legend 'Seal of the Royal Society of New Zealand' substituted therefor, be the common seal of the Society.”
SECTION F. VI.—CARTER BEQUEST.
Delete.
M. WOOD,
Secretary.
